Three Aglaspids

Late Cambrian, Tasmania, Australia

Aglaspis sp. -- This creature is NOT a trilobite. Aglaspids are more closely related to eurypterids and horseshoe crabs and have only been found at fewer than 10 places in the world. They are almost entirely restricted to the Late Cambrian and seem to have gone extinct by the Silurian. Although this Tasmanian species was identified as Aglaspis in the only paper ever mentioning this find, it clearly differs from the genus Aglaspis enough that it is probably an entirely new genus and species.
